Entertainment in Orange County

Television

Watching television is a favorite past-time of inmates in the Orange County Jail (California) just trying to pass their time. Many inmates, however, get sick of the TV in jail because they report that the same channels are always on (it is up to the guards to turn the televisions on and change the channels) and it is hard to agree with other inmates on what to watch (when the guards are willing to change the channels).

Working out

While the jail does not offer workout facilities (weights, treadmills, etc.), many inmates report working out as one of their most common ways to pass the time. Apparently being a racist jail (read dealing with other inmates) each race wants their inmates to be like soldiers - they often require that you work out and stay in shape.

Without regular workout facilities most inmates just do pushups, sit-ups and other exercises that don't require any equipment. Many inmates report coming out of jail in better shape than they went in - this is especially common with inmates serving time on drug-related charges.

Cards, dominoes, chess

These games of skill are surprisingly populat at the Orange County Jail - many inmates gamble commissary in games which is against the jail's rules. If you are caught doing it you may get in trouble though no inmates report that it is a very serious offense.

Reading books

This is probably the most common way to pass time in jail - mostly because you can choose what you want to read. Your family can send you books as long as they are new and come directly from the store - Amazon.com is the most popular choice for most people buying books for inmates.

Going outside

In general you are supposed to have one hour per day to go out in the yard. This depends, however, on the behavior of other inmates and it is frequently taken away. Many inmates choose not to go outside, however, since they spend so much time being searched going out to the yard and coming back in (a necessary precaution because they are allowed to see other inmates and could possibly pass things back and forth).
